Is MAX POWER TRANSPORT INC safe to work with?

Is MAX POWER TRANSPORT INC safe to load? MAX POWER TRANSPORT INC (USDOT 2724602, MC-922811) is an active small-fleet motor carrier based in DES PLAINES, IL, operating 165 power units and 165 drivers. Operating authority has been active 11 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 213 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 29.5% (above the 22.26% national average), with 13 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it clear to load (87/100).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-07-18.
